## Service accounts — SproutTimer scheduler

SproutTimer uses one service account per environment. The scheduler account calls the internal MistRelay API to dispatch watering jobs; scope is limited to job create/read, no device admin. Rotation is quarterly, owned by the Ferrow platform team. No human logins; console access disabled. Audit logs ship to the central sink with 90-day retention. Review items: scope creep on the prod account, and the stale dev account flagged last cycle. The prod account authenticates with the key below.

gateway credential: kto3_qfe

Handover — Priya to Col, Facilities Desk, Marrowgate Exchange. Goods lift 2 is reserved for deliveries all week — do not release it to movers or catering. Wexford Freight has three pallet drops Tuesday and Thursday, dock side only. Keep the lift lobby clear of cages; security flagged it twice already. If the lift call panel asks for authorisation after 18:00, use the delivery override below.

staff pass of kawip-hawef = bdg-QLP-2

### Lingothresh extraction failures

If the nightly string-extraction run for Lingothresh bails out halfway, check the parser log first — nine times out of ten someone committed a template with an unescaped brace and the tokenizer gave up. Rerun with the --salvage flag to skip bad files and still push partial catalogs to the Murrowfen translation service. You'll need to re-auth manually since the cron identity doesn't carry over to ad-hoc runs. Use the Murrowfen service key below when prompted.

API key for kahop-bagef: zpat2_yb

**Q: Nightsower backfill scheduler won't start after credential rotation. Fix?**

The scheduler seals its secrets vault whenever rotation fails mid-cycle. Check `nightsower.log` for a SEAL event. If present, stop all pending backfill jobs, then unseal manually before restarting. Do not re-run rotation first; it compounds the lock. Unsealing requires the recovery passphrase recorded directly below this entry.

unlock words, fafop-hawep: briwyn-oliix-sorox